Freshman Valerie Keehmer, a driver for the University of La Verne womens water polo team, scored three goals, including the game winner, in the 7-6 overtime victory against Sonoma State April 4. The Leopards are currently 2-2 in conference play with an overall record of 5-13. Their next home match will be against Claremont-Mudd-Scripps, scheduled for 5 p.m. Wednesday.

Returning a serve in her first game, Desiree Whipperman, No. 6 singles for the La Verne womens tennis team, was defeated by Aimme Fiore of Cal Lutheran in two games, 6-0, 6-2. The Leopards were shut out by Cal Lutheran, 9-0 on April 2. Their SCIAC record is now 2-4.
